Ethernet I/O Controller for Cost-effective, Intelligent Handling of I/O

Description

Galil Motion Control, an industry pioneer in motion control technology, introduces its new, compact RIO-47100 (RIO) remote I/O controller, which connects to the Ethernet and provides an intelligent, cost-effective method for adding inputs and outputs to a variety of motion and non-motion applications. Priced at just $295 in single quantity and $195 in quantities of 100, each RIO unit is self-contained and provides numerous analog and digital I/O including 8 analog inputs, 8 analog outputs, 16 optically isolated inputs, 8 high-power isolated outputs up to 500mA each, and 8 low-power isolated outputs up to 25mA each. Multiple RIO units can be distributed on an Ethernet network allowing for I/O expansion. Additionally, the RIO contains a powerful RISC processor for handling I/O logic at high speeds. It also provides on-board memory and multitasking which frees the host computer and motion controller for handling other tasks. “Designers who demand built-in intelligence will appreciate the RIO,” says Lisa Wade, VP-Sales and Marketing. “We’ve packed plenty of intelligent features into a compact package, including logical and arithmetic operators, conditional statements, process control loops, pulse counters, variables and arrays.” Standard features also include easy programming using Galil’s simple two-letter command language, a web interface that permits viewing of status and changing of I/O states without installing additional software, and email capability that allows messages to be sent remotely.
